Scan for fire risks


As you examine your valves, provide its environments an once over. Scan the location for fire threats, especially if you utilize a gas-powered hot water heater.
First, check for combustible products like fuel, gas storage tanks, as well as various other heat-generating appliances. Next, look for littles paper and wood, consisting of garbage. Do not deal with your trash near to your hot water heater equipment.
You would do well to maintain any kind of clothes far from your water heater. Must a fire beginning, these materials will facilitate its spread. That stated, your washing line need to not be close to your hot water heater.

Always maintain appropriate air flow


If your hot water heater isn't effectively aired vent, it'll lead fumes right into your home. This could set off breathing problems and also offer you cough or an allergic reaction.
A good vent ought to deal with up or have a vertical slant, leading the smoke far from the family. If your air vent does not follow this layout, it might be an installment mistake.
You require a plumber's aid to fix poor water heater ventilation.

Inspect your Pressure and Temperature Valves


Your hot water heater's temperature level as well as stress valves regulate the temperature and also stress within the hot water heater storage tank. These valves will protect against a surge if your storage tank gets too hot or if the stress surpasses risk-free levels.
Unfortunately, these safety and security tools provide no warning when they spoil. You can validate your shutoff's effectiveness by holding on to the shutoff's bar. If it is in good condition, water should spurt. If no water spurts or only a trickle is launched, rush as well as get your shutoffs taken care of.

    Tips to Increase the Lifespan of your Water Heater


    Turn OFF the geyser when not in use


    Turn the geyser off when you are done using it. It will help decrease power consumption, extend lifespan, and save money on water heater repair. The water does not turn cold, even after switching the geyser off, as the storage tank holds the temperature of the water for 4-5 hours.


    Proper Installation


    Proper space should be left around the water heater. It should not feel crowded, and giving room to breathe increases airflow and reduces the risk of fires. This gives you optimal space for completing routine system maintenance checks without difficulty. Nothing should be kept near or under the geyser. The geyser should be installed away from wet areas, like the bathtub, shower, or toilet.


    Insulate your Water Heater


    Insulation should be installed around the pipes and the water heater to make it more energy efficient and to increase the water temperature by 2-4 degrees. During the summertime, this keeps the pipes from sweating or forming condensation. It can also protect your cold water pipes from freezing and potentially bursting during cooler months. Insulation may cut heat loss by as much as 45% and your expenditures for overheating the water.


    Replace the Sacrificial Anode


    Water heaters are equipped with a sacrificial anode to prevent corrosion by hard water. The anode rod protects the tank from rusting on the inside and should be checked yearly. Without a rod or a properly functioning anode rod, the hot water quickly corrodes inside the tank. It can last anywhere from five to ten years. However, the amount of water you use and the hardness of your water determines its need for replacement.


    Install a Water Softener


    f you live in an area where the mineral content is high in the water systems, then installing a water softener might help expand the lifespan of your water heater. When an area has high mineral content (calcium and magnesium) in the water, it’s known as hard water. Hard water leaves deposits to form at the bottom of the water heater, which causes them to have problems much sooner than expected. To prevent this from happening, install a water softener that filters out the minerals that make the water hard, allowing only soft water to flow through the pipes.


    Lower the Temperature


    Lowering the temperature of your geyser will help you save electricity, increase its life, and the geyser will have to work less. Maintaining a temperature of 120 degrees Fahrenheit to eradicate the vast majority of pathogens is a good thumb rule. The hotter your hot water supply is, the more energy it will consume.
